What is a CD key and where can I find it?

Steam's explanation and list of Steam-activatable keys

The CD Key is a serial number with a combination of 13, 18, or 25 letters and numbers - it can be found on a sticker inside your game's case or printed on the game's quick reference card. The CD Key acts as your proof of purchase for the game - Steam Support may ask for it if you need to establish your ownership of an account. It is recommended that you keep your CD Key in a safe place to ensure the security of your account.

What I like about Giana Sisters is that it's challenging without feeling punishing. I don't feel like every level is intentionally trying to punish me for attempting to progress through it. Instead, they present challenges that may look incredibly difficult at first, but can be overcome, especially if you sometimes take a moment to think of what actions need to be taken which is nice since there's no time limit for the levels either. I've completed 2 out of the 3(?) worlds so far, and have been thoroughly enjoying the game.
